  German inventor Karl Benz patented what is generally regarded as the first modern car.
- 
  
  Massachusetts and Missouri became the first states to require a driver’s license.
- 
  
  Massachusetts instituted a chauffeur exam.
- 
  
  Henry Ford launched the Model T, the first affordable automobile for many middle-class Americans.
- 
  
  When Ford’s native state of Michigan started issuing driver’s licenses, he got his first one at age 56
- 
  
  The state of Massachusetts started requiring tests for all other drivers.
- 
  
  Only 24 states required a license to drive a car and just 15 states had mandatory driver’s exams.
